Allergic Rhinitis
IgE-mediated inflammation of the nasal lining causing sneezing, congestion and itch.
Overview
Allergic rhinitis affects 10–30% of adults and up to 40% of children. Seasonal (hay fever) is driven by pollens; perennial by dust mites, animal dander or moulds. It commonly coexists with asthma, eczema and conjunctivitis and significantly impacts sleep, school and work performance.
Symptoms
- • Sneezing, clear nasal discharge, nasal blockage
- • Itchy nose, eyes, palate or throat
- • Postnasal drip and cough
- • Watery, red eyes (allergic conjunctivitis)
- • Fatigue and poor concentration from disturbed sleep
Risk factors
- • Personal or family history of atopy
- • Early-life allergen exposure and tobacco smoke
- • Air pollution
Causes
- • Pollens (tree, grass, weed) — seasonal pattern
- • House dust mite, animal dander, moulds, cockroach — perennial pattern
- • Occupational allergens (flour, latex, laboratory animals)
🚨 Red flags — seek urgent care
- • Unilateral bloody nasal discharge — exclude tumour, foreign body
- • Facial pain, fever, purulent discharge — bacterial sinusitis
- • Breathlessness or wheeze — assess asthma

Diagnosis
- • Clinical pattern (timing, triggers, family history)
- • Skin-prick testing or specific IgE blood tests
- • Nasal examination: pale, swollen turbinates with clear secretions
- • Spirometry if asthma symptoms
Treatment
- • Allergen avoidance (mite-proof bedding, HEPA filtration, pet exclusion)
- • Intranasal saline rinses
- • Intranasal corticosteroid (mometasone, fluticasone) — first-line for moderate–severe
- • Non-sedating oral antihistamine (loratadine, cetirizine, fexofenadine)
- • Combined intranasal corticosteroid + antihistamine spray for inadequate control
- • Leukotriene receptor antagonist (montelukast) if comorbid asthma
- • Allergen immunotherapy (sublingual or subcutaneous) for refractory or single-allergen disease
Prevention
- • Pollen avoidance during peak counts; sunglasses outdoors; shower after high-exposure days
- • Damp-dust and HEPA vacuum weekly; wash bedding at 60°C
- • Stop smoking and reduce indoor air pollution
Complications
- • Asthma development or worsening
- • Recurrent sinusitis, otitis media with effusion
- • Sleep disturbance, reduced productivity
Prognosis
Symptoms often persist for life but are well controlled with consistent therapy. Immunotherapy modifies disease and reduces long-term medication burden.

Frequently asked questions
Is allergic rhinitis the same as hay fever?
Hay fever is seasonal allergic rhinitis. Perennial allergic rhinitis is the year-round form.
Are nasal steroid sprays safe long term?
Yes — at standard doses they are safe for prolonged use; technique matters more than dose.
Will it ever go away on its own?
Allergic rhinitis often eases with age but rarely disappears entirely. Daily intranasal steroid sprays remain the most effective long-term treatment, and allergen immunotherapy can produce lasting remission in selected people.
Are non-drowsy antihistamines safe long-term?
Yes. Loratadine, cetirizine and fexofenadine are well tolerated for years of continuous use. Older sedating antihistamines (chlorphenamine, promethazine) should be reserved for short-term night-time use.
Can it trigger asthma?
Up to 40% of people with allergic rhinitis also have asthma, and poorly controlled nasal symptoms worsen asthma control. Treating the nose often improves chest symptoms too.
